Conduction disorder and QT prolongation secondary to long-term treatment with chloroquine

Int J Cardiol. 2008 Jul 4;127(2):e80-2. doi: 10.1016/j.ijcard.2007.04.055. Epub 2007 Jun 27.

Abstract

A patient with polymorphic ventricular tachycardia, long QT interval and conduction disorders secondary to long-term treatment with chloroquine is presented.
